He soon realized just how good she was.

Early the next morning, as the first light of dawn broke, it roused him from his sleep.

He raised his hand to shield his eyes from the sunlight coming from the east, and then he heard a ringing sound next to his pillow.

He answered the call and placed it to his ear, hearing the voice on the other end say, “Young Master Li, I actually wanted to tell you yesterday that after an unexpected interview, I had a burst of inspiration and spent the whole day discussing the plot with that junior screenwriter. By the time we finished, it was already midnight, so I forgot to mention it.”

“I found the person you asked me to look for. It wasn’t through the countless photos online but through the live audition. Her name is Jiang Rao, she’s twenty-two this year, and she looks exactly like the photo you showed me! I’ll send you a multimedia message shortly so you can see if she’s the one you’re looking for.”

“No need.”

“What’s wrong? Have you changed your mind about your dream goddess?”

Li Jueyan was silent for a moment. “Feng Ke, did you help her get the more than 400,000 yuan she needed?”

Feng Ke replied, “More than 400,000? I only instructed the staff to transfer her the reward money she was owed. After taxes, it was just 400,000, not more.”

“Feng Ke, is this what I meant?”

The voice on the other end of the line was slow but cold.

Even Feng Ke, who usually had a thick skin, realized he might have made a mistake.

The crux of the mistake was that he shouldn’t have given the reward money to the girl.

Understanding this, he nervously explained, “I couldn’t not give it to her, Young Master Li. So many eyes were on it! This Jiang Rao not only resembles Jiang Tang by about 50 to 60%, but she also fits the role of Ruan Li in ‘Yanyan’ by 80%. My plan was to see how things went in the next couple of days. If I couldn’t find a better candidate, then I’d cast her for Ruan Li. With this in mind, I couldn’t just come up with an excuse to withhold the money.”

“Already given, then that’s fine. Did I say anything to you that makes you so afraid?”

His words were reasonable, but his tone made Feng Ke break out in a cold sweat, “So… Young Master Li, can I still use that girl in the movie?”

Li Jueyan’s first reaction was that if someone had offended him, there was no way he would want to use them.

However, he suddenly remembered everything he had thought about her the day before.

He thought to himself that if he was so good and outstanding, then her not recognizing it was just her being blind.

Outstanding people wouldn’t engage in manipulative tactics out of personal desire.

But he still couldn’t let it go, so he sneered, “I’m just a dumb investor with too much money. Why does everyone need to ask me about everything? What do they need you, the director, for?”

With that, he slammed the phone down.

He then used the remote to close the curtains, driving the last sliver of sunlight out of the room.

After doing so, he lay back down on his pillow. However, once he closed his eyes, he felt no trace of drowsiness. Not only was he wide awake, but he also thought about the peaceful night he had experienced without any nightmares.

He had once pleaded daily for those damned nightmares to leave him alone at the beginning, but the heavens seemed to ignore him completely, subjecting him to a never-ending love story.

Now that he had grown accustomed to those recurring nightmares, suddenly not dreaming at all after signing that receipt last night was strange.

He took a deep breath, his voice tinged with uncontrollable coldness. “Great, just great! Completely cut off.”

Jiang Rao also felt it was great.

She had endured three months of tormenting nightmares.

In those dreams, she had personally experienced every scene.

Now, everything had finally come to an end, and with that receipt, a definite conclusion had been reached between her and the male lead.

If she had known that sorting everything out with the male lead would result in this, she… well, there was nothing she could have done.

The flutter of a butterfly’s wings might trigger a storm on the other side of the world.

Reaching this point was the best possible outcome. Worrying about other things was just adding unnecessary trouble and exhaustion for herself.

It wasn’t worth it.

While there was no need to consider that, there was one thing she urgently needed to focus on—making money!

After repaying the 2.18 million yuan the male lead required, she was left completely penniless.

Aside from the remaining 20,000 yuan in her bag, she had no other assets.

She had given up on renting, but she needed to earn money for studying abroad.

For a girl from a lower background, beauty wasn’t a luxury; it was a necessity.

In other words, the poorer someone was, the more beautiful they tended to become, making it easier for them to stray off the right path. This was because countless people superior to her were coveting her beauty.

Even those closest to her could be like that.

Only by elevating her education, title, social status, and so on, could she truly acquire a protective shield.

Studying abroad was the opportunity that could help her elevate all these aspects, and she had already taken the IELTS exam; she didn’t want to give up.

Jiang Rao pondered over the more profitable professions of this era.

After much consideration, she decided to head to Hangcheng.

This was the year when e-commerce was on the rise. Although the new profession of Taobao models might not earn as much as in later years, it was still much more lucrative than most other industries.

If she saved up, it should be possible to earn two to three hundred thousand yuan in a year.

Acting on her thoughts, she tidied herself up and headed to the airport with her backpack full of reference books.

Her identity was already exposed, and her relationship with the male lead had been clarified, so there was no need to endure the suffering of train travel any longer.

She had just bought her plane ticket and was waiting in the departure lounge when, on the desk of a certain president, appeared a 1080p photo of her, sitting obediently with her back against the chair and studying vocabulary from an English dictionary.

Li Jueyan’s eyes turned cold. “You said she bought a ticket to Hangcheng?”

“Yes, President Li.”

“That wild big brother of hers who has no blood relation to her, is he from Hangcheng University?”

Wild big brother…

Xiao Zhang’s brow twitched, and he couldn’t help but clear his throat. “That’s right, President Li.”

Li Jueyan leaned back in his chair.

After a long pause, he said slowly, “Tell Feng Ke to carefully screen people. All the qualified candidates should be sent to me for review, and I’ll choose one as a lover.”

Wasn’t he supposed to find a replacement?

Such things were common in high society.

He rarely felt any affection for women and had even laughed at his peers who, after losing their first loves1, acted as if they couldn’t go on living another day, appearing like fools to him.

He would never become such a fool.

There were plenty of people who could replace her.

Plenty!
